Output 386e1c3cf8153bc46eda52b0370644c7248736669533be627cb1014012eaa6e9:82

value
107799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f72c5cb2b1fb1df43c855d7186f69946656f82 OP_EQUAL
address
3QqryygWsSBYT3JmRUrboG8K5tVpkSytpA
transaction
386e1c3cf8153bc46eda52b0370644c7248736669533be627cb1014012eaa6e9
confirmations
226620
spent
true